How to properly use the PT 112 Ergo hand truck to load without the risk of tipping?
Load heavy items at the bottom and lighter ones at the top to lower the center of gravity. On ramps and uneven surfaces, push the hand truck (do not pull it) for full control. The nominal capacity of 325 kg applies to centered loads on a flat surface—reduce the maximum load by 30% on uneven or inclined surfaces. Tilt the hand truck towards yourself before moving—never move with the load vertical.
PT 112 Ergo vs PT 112 (No. 31) — what is the concrete difference?
The PT 112 Ergo has an ergonomic contoured handle that reduces wrist strain during long movements—a noticeable difference in intensive use (dozens of movements per day). The PT 112 No. 31 has a standard straight handle. For occasional use, the difference is marginal; for daily professional use, the Ergo reduces fatigue.
